This question is for the docs. I am about 5 weeks away from surgery and I have just quite smoking in preparation. Can you please let me know if quitting 5 weeks ahead is ample time to reduce some risks that cigarette's cause for surgery?

4 weeks ahead of surgery and 2 weeks post op are definitely no-smoking.  The two major complications with smoking and this surgery is (1) unprecitable effects during anesthesia and (2) healing.  By far the most important thing is healing.  With any kind of nicotine exposure, you get suboptimal circulation, which will definitely affect your healing post op.  Since you quit 5 weeks ahead, I think you are quite safe from complications, plus you will start to feel much better now that you quit!  Keep it up, and try to get through any cravings... just remember that cravings last a few minutes so just get through them and stay smoke free.  Like some other members on here (including me) you might find that after surgery you will not have a desire for cigarettes anymore.
